Прочитать кириллицу из файла - C#

Узнай цену своей работы

Формулировка задачи:

Привет. Мне нужно прочитать данные из обычного txt-файла. Числа и латинские символы читаются нормально, а вот с кириллицей возникают проблемы, вместо нее кракозябры. Подскажите, пожалуйста, как решить проблему?
FileStream fs;
StreamReader sr;
 
fs = File.Open(path, FileMode.Open, FileAccess.Read, FileShare.None);
sr = new StreamReader(fs);
 
     ...
 
String str = sr.ReadLine();

Решение задачи: «Прочитать кириллицу из файла»

textual
Листинг программы
new StreamReader(fs, Encoding.Default);

ИИ поможет Вам:


  • решить любую задачу по программированию
  • объяснить код
  • расставить комментарии в коде
  • и т.д
Попробуйте бесплатно

Оцени полезность:

10   голосов , оценка 4.2 из 5
Похожие ответы